by Xymph » 17 Apr 2008 09:14
Xilvero wrote:Make sure your configuration file is NOT in the root of the server. That is NOT where it belongs. That was my issue.
I dont have it there! I tried it 10 times:
-I unpacked the rarfile in a random folder.
-I opened dedicated_cgf.txt and filled in the various tags.
-I tried opening TrackmaniaServer.exe.
- Got the same error as Robi!!
You can't just run the executable, you need to supply several options, so it's easier to create a .bat file with all those. See my next post.
